Mandatory Testing and Certification of Telecom Equipment (MTCTE) in India


What is MTCTE and why does MTCTE certificate matter for telecom equipment


MTCTE stands for mandatory testing and certification of telecom equipment. It is the mechanism through which the government of India ensures that every telecom product introduced for use in India meets prescribed standards. When a router base station or any piece of telecom equipment is sold in India . It must be safe for networks and users. MTCTE certificate was created to ensure devices do not cause harmful interference do not exceed radio frequency limits and comply with essential requirements that protect public communication networks.

The telecommunication engineering center or TEC evaluates whether equipment meets these essential requirements and issues a TEC certificate when the product passes conformity assessment. The MTCTE scheme is not paperwork for its own sake. It is about conformance and about keeping existing network performance and public safety intact. TEC Certification Testing

TEC Certification directs all telecom equipment to undergo mandatory testing and certification (MTCTE) prior to sale or import for use in India.

MTCTE is carried out to check conformance with essential requirements of the equipment,  by TEC-designated labs.
Essential Requirements (ER) includes EMI/ EMC, Safety, technical requirements, and other requirements as notified by TEC/ DoT.
The lab also has the capability to support safety testing per IEC 62368-1, IEC 60215, IP testing per IEC 60529, and environmental tests per QM 333.

There are two types of TEC MTCTE Certification schemes:


  1. General Certification Scheme (GCS): Under this TEC MTCTE Certification scheme, the applicant shall be required to submit test wise compliance (summary sheet provided with the test report) along with the test reports itself, in accordance with the parameters included in the Essential Requirements (ERs), from any designated Conformity Assessment Bodies (CAB) or recognized CAB of Mutual Recognition Arrangement (MRA) partner country. The test results shall be evaluated for compliance against respective ERs.
  2. Simplified Certification Scheme (SCS): Under this TEC MTCTE Certification scheme, the applicant must test the product in accordance with the Essential Requirements and submit a test wise compliance sheet along with a Self-Declaration of Conformity (SDoC), in accordance with the parameters included in the ERs. All other rules/procedures that apply under the GCS shall apply in case of SCS, with the exception of the test reports, which are not required to be submitted by the applicant or evaluated by TEC. TEC certification, however, reserves the right to request a copy of the test report from the applicant to be submitted.
  3. The Essential Requirements describe the technical regulations prescribed under this framework which include:
  • Safety
  • Electromagnetic interference (EMI)/Electromagnetic Compatibility (EMC)
  • Technical requirements (including wireless / radio frequency (RF))
  • Security: To be notified by Department of Telecommunication (DoT)
  • Other requirements: To be notified by DoT
